Transaction 20c13516e61aa25bc86c2fa59ba8f8ad8475acb3c70f3b6656966d52da72bb6b
1 Input
1 Output
-
20c13516e61aa25bc86c2fa59ba8f8ad8475acb3c70f3b6656966d52da72bb6b:0
- value
- 3216013
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badcb0ac895c2c44d876a0f368032f2053f9813
- address
- bc1qewkukzkgjhpvgnv8dg8ndqpj7gznlxqnf72wyg